It has been a privilege to serve as Head Coach for Angkor Tiger FC
From Day 1 the people of Cambodia have welcomed me warmly and supported the changes I implemented at the club.

By working tirelessly, the team & I have overcome many limitations, with some unforgettable victories and memories. I hope that the fans remember these moments, and continue to support the team as the club evolves.

To all of the players, staff, and fans; thank you for your support, providing additional strength to the team on-and-off the field.
I am confident in the future of Cambodian football.
I am proud to have been able to partly contribute to this exciting footballing revolution.

It has been a wonderful journey in a new part of the world for me and it is time for me to return to my home country of the United Kingdom. I am excited to seek out a new challenge and will do so with Cambodia in my heart.

Chemistry is an important aspect of any football side. Having good communication and understanding between players and staff, amongst players, and amongst staff is critical for us to reach our goals.

Links are certainly not forged overnight and while it takes time, it is important to implement strategies to expedite the process. This season, with an influx of new players and staff, it was important to plan and prepare ahead so that we are united in achieving our targets.

Above all, team bonding activities have played a crucial role this season to breakthrough socio-cultural and language barriers.

To have success on the pitch, it is critical to create the necessary conditions off it.
